2,400 Avios with £60 LEGO spend
Tesco Direct is running a ‘short but sweet’ offer on LEGO.
Until Wednesday night, you will receive 1,000 Clubcard points (worth 2,400 Avios or 2,500 Virgin Flying Club) when you spend £60 on the plastic stuff.

Special Etihad economy deal to Hong Kong
Etihad is running a special promotional code on Hong Kong flights at the moment. Using code JUNE30 you can fly from Heathrow to Hong Kong for just £344. This is exceptional value for such a long trip and is £25 cheaper than the current Cathay Pacific sale prices – albeit that flight is direct and earns Avios.
I’m not sure of the exact travel dates but I was able to find dates in June at this price.
15% off Iberia flights from the UK – today only
Iberia has been running a special discount for its newsletter subscribers this week which I forgot to mention over the weekend.
It is still valid today, however, and you can fly until the end of the year (July and August excluded).
The code ‘INTERNET’ used on iberia.com will get you 15% off economy or business class flights departing from the UK.
It is valid only on Iberia and Air Nostrum. No stopover are allowed.
